Josh Abelow's stock seems to be on
the rise. With this, his second solo show with the Fuentes Gallery
Abelow presents recent works examining his status within the art world
community while paying homage to its most influential personalities.
Operating not only as a painter but as a blogger and curator, Abelow has
attracted a community of sympathetic fans and supporters who
are posed to push his dream of joining the art historic canon over the tipping point. Working with a light hand and an almost childlike simplicity, his reductive compositions nonetheless contain sophisticated graphic and coloristic content.
